Output 76f3a3cdc25fa8a69997bfe573fa04dec2b97247a2c7cbc71dce9b692ab3e684:1

value
237900
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8d20a03573086d13f232599b4026b4314bd6385e OP_EQUAL
address
3EZEHUQGRKCovjqoaa6pMJazBAovXYVUDQ
transaction
76f3a3cdc25fa8a69997bfe573fa04dec2b97247a2c7cbc71dce9b692ab3e684
confirmations
100873
spent
true